Desk Correspondent , Washington D.C - Jennifer Lopez has broken her silence regarding her emotional journey following her divorce from Ben Affleck, offering a powerful perspective on love and personal growth. In a candid interview, the singer and actress emphasized that her recent experiences have led to a profound shift in how she views self-worth. Lopez shared that she has spent significant time reflecting on her patterns in relationships, concluding that her love is no longer something she gives away freely. "If you want my love, you have to earn it," she stated, signaling a definitive new chapter centered on self-respect and boundaries.

The "Atlas" star admitted that the transition has been challenging but ultimately liberating. She described the period following the split as a time of "re-evaluating everything," where she learned to find happiness within herself rather than seeking validation from a partner. Lopez spoke about the importance of being "whole" on her own, noting that she is currently prioritizing her peace and her children. Her reflections resonate with many who have followed the "Bennifer" saga, as she moves away from the romanticized narratives of the past toward a more grounded and self-reliant outlook.

This new stance on "earning" her affection marks a departure from her previous public image as a perennial romantic. By speaking openly about the pain of divorce and the necessity of self-love, Lopez aims to inspire other women to recognize their own value. As she focuses on her upcoming projects and personal healing, she remains firm that any future partner must meet her elevated standards of respect and effort. Her message is clear: while she remains open to life’s possibilities, her days of settling for anything less than she deserves are officially over.
